Advanced Components: Research Guides Accessibility Lessons Series

Wednesday, 12/10, 3:00 pm-3:50 pm

Please join the Research Guides Team for our sixth accessibility lesson of the fall 2025 semester. During this workshop, we’ll focus on the responsible use of tables, tabbed boxes, and custom widgets in Research Guides. We emphasize using these advanced components only when necessary, providing best practices for accessibility with detailed instructions on accessible table features, avoiding tables for visual layout, and making your tabbed boxes and custom widgets accessible.
